## Auth for the log sampler

Quick context for whoever inherits this: Chatterbin got so noisy we sample its logs at 2% before shipping them to Lognest. The sampler runs as a sidecar and needs to authenticate against the ingest API — no anonymous writes anymore, sorry. Rotation happens monthly-ish; if ingestion suddenly flatlines, the credential probably expired. For local testing, export the same header the sidecar uses, namely the bearer token below.

bearer token for tawig-bahif: eyJhbGciOiJIUzI1NiIsInR5cCI6IkpXVCJ9.eyJzdWIiOiIo-yiO33jvEIn0.T9qLInSAqhTN

Management Meeting Minutes — Legacy Pricing

Attendees: department heads, chaired by R. Falwick. Agreed to move legacy Almora customers to the current rate card over two billing cycles, with a 12-month grace option for accounts above the top usage band. Support and billing to coordinate notices; comms draft due in ten days. No exceptions without Falwick's approval. A confidential note on related plans follows below.

management briefing: Project Ulavan slips by two quarters because of the staffing delay.

- [ ] Step 7: Archive cold storage buckets (Glacierline tier). Confirm both ceremony witnesses are present, verify bucket manifests match the Oxbow ledger, then seal the archive key shares. Plugin authors may observe but not handle shares. Once sealed, the archive index itself is encrypted and can only be reopened with the passphrase below.

vault phrase of badup-hahig = tamael-aldael-kelmir-istael-fenok-istwyn-tamius-jorath-oliion